概括
眼内压力与近视进展没有相关性. 然而,抗瘤药物与高度近视眼睛的轴长度延长的减少有关,这表明潜在的IOP独立治疗益处.

背景情况:
- 高近视 (HM) 与严重的眼部并发症有关.
- 了解影响轴长度 (AXL) 延长和近视性黄斑变性 (MMD) 的因素对于管理HM至关重要.
- 眼内压力 (IOP) 和其管理在HM进展中的作用仍然是一个研究领域.
研究的目的:
- 为了检查IOP和抗白内障药物与MMD,后部稳形瘤和HM眼中的AXL延长之间的关系.
- 为了确定HM进展的预测因素.
- 为了探索青光眼药物对内膜片独立的影响.
主要方法:
- 追溯多民族队列研究,包括988个HM眼睛.
- 进行了横截面和纵向分析.
- 后勤和线性回归模型评估了IOP,MMD,稳形瘤,AXL和抗白血病药物使用之间的关联.
主要成果:
- 在非白内障眼中,IOP与MMD,稳形瘤或AXL没有显著的关联.
- 较长的AXL与各种眼睛结构变化相关.
- 使用抗白血病药物与随时间的推移而减少的AXL延长有关,独立于IOP.
结论:
- 在HM眼中,IOP不是结构变化或AXL在HM眼中进展的重要因素.
- 抗瘤药物可以通过IOP独立的机制减少HM眼睛的AXL延长.
- 在HM眼中对AXL的药理学调节是一种潜在的治疗途径.

Glaucoma: Overview
1.4K
Glaucoma is an eye condition characterized by increased intraocular pressure that damages the retina and optic nerve, leading to irreversible blindness if left untreated. The human eye has various components, including the cornea, iris, pupil, lens, and optic nerve. Aqueous humor is secreted by the epithelium of the ciliary body in the posterior chamber and flows through the trabecular meshwork and canal of Schlemm, maintaining normal intraocular pressure. Open Angle Glaucoma: Treatment
1.0K
In open-angle glaucoma, the iridocorneal angle remains open, but the trabecular meshwork becomes stiff, slowing down the outflow of aqueous humor. This causes a buildup of aqueous humor in the anterior chamber, leading to a sudden increase in intraocular pressure. The treatment for open-angle glaucoma focuses on reducing the elevated intraocular pressure by either decreasing the secretion of aqueous humor or increasing its outflow.

Focusing of Light in the Eye
6.4K
Light rays enter the eye through the cornea, a transparent dome-shaped tissue that is the eye's outermost layer. The cornea bends or refracts, light rays traveling to the pupil. The shape of the cornea determines how much of the light is bent and whether the image will be focused correctly on the retina at the back of the eye.
